Darwen Market Introduces two great new stalls

Published Thursday 17 May 2018 at 11:58

Darwen Market has welcomed two new businesses to the Market Hall.

Home Essentials has been trading for a few weeks now and Making Memories opened on Saturday, May 12.

Home Essentials sells a range of goods, from cleaning products to light bulbs, mops and buckets to graters, stationary to candles and pocket money toys. This stall is an Aladdin’s cave of delights for everyone!

Proprietor Sue said:

I have been overwhelmed by the friendliness of the welcome to Darwen Market; not just from fellow traders, but from the lovely customers that have been coming to the stall.”

I have had lots of people say that they are impressed with the stall, which is good to hear. I know that locally people wanted a household products stall, so I am keen for people to know I’m here”.

Making Memories Haberdashery is a new stall that is a feast for the eyes, selling items such as wool, ribbon, cotton, knitting needles, crochet hooks etc. as well as memory bears. Stall holder Melanie explains that she has set up this business in her mother’s memory.

Melanie said:

I have been a childminder for over 12 years but have had a passion for making memory bears. I have had to travel out of Darwen to purchase all the materials that I needed and I decided that I could set something up to meet this demand, not only for myself, but for the other people in the town that were in the same boat”.

I lost my Mum to cancer eight weeks ago and she has been my inspiration. The name of the stall is in memory of my Mum and in the hope that this stall will allow other people to make memories too”.
